What Are Termites and Do I Need To Have Them Treated?
The termites or “white ants” found in Upstate NY and throughout most of North America are Eastern Subterranean Termites. The subterranean termite is by far the most destructive termite species. These termites live in underground colonies or in moist secluded areas above ground. Termites feed on plant matter and products made of cellulose which explains their attraction to wood. By using their hard saw-toothed jaws like shears they are able to bite off extremely small fragments of wood, one piece at a time which puts structures that include wood at risk for termite damage. Termite colonies will not only damage the structural integrity of homes, but they can collapse a building entirely over time if left untreated. Termites cause over two billion in property damage within the United States each year.
What Are Common Signs Of Termites?
Mud (shelter) tubes in basements or along foundation walls are signs that termites are present. Shelter tubes made of dirt and saliva are constructed by termites to protect themselves from open air while gaining access to food sources. At times, usually in the Spring, termites will try to establish new colonies. Special black termites with wings are the colonists. Seeing flying black termites or their cast off wings is a sign of termite infestation.

The Termite Caste System
The reproductive members, also known as the kings and queens are brown or black in color, have wings and are the largest termites in the colony.
The worker members make up a majority of the colony and they are creamy white in color, blind and wingless. They have the duty of foraging for food and water, constructing and repairing shelter tubes, and care for the eggs and young.
Soldier members only make up about 1-2% of the colony. They are also white in color and wingless, they resemble the worker caste but they have mandibles. The primary function of the soldier caste is to defend the colony.
